文章詳情頁
mysql無法添加外鍵
瀏覽:76日期:2022-06-17 14:05:31
問題描述
問題解答
回答1:如果重新創建已刪除的表,則它必須具有符合引用它的外鍵約束的定義。 它必須具有正確的列名稱和類型,并且必須在引用的鍵上有索引,如前所述。 如果這些不滿足,MySQL返回錯誤1005并引用錯誤消息中的錯誤150,這意味著外鍵約束沒有正確形成。 類似地,如果ALTER TABLE由于錯誤150而失敗,則意味著對于已更改的表,將不正確地形成外鍵定義。
http://stackoverflow.com/ques...
相關文章:
1. MySQL數據庫中文亂碼的原因2. angular.js - 關于$apply()3. dockerfile - 我用docker build的時候出現下邊問題 麻煩幫我看一下4. angular.js使用$resource服務把數據存入mongodb的問題。5. nignx - docker內nginx 80端口被占用6. mysql - 新浪微博中的關注功能是如何設計表結構的?7. angular.js - Ionic 集成crosswalk后生成的apk在android4.4.2上安裝失敗???8. dockerfile - [docker build image失敗- npm install]9. css - C#與java開發Windows程序哪個好?10. 如何解決Centos下Docker服務啟動無響應,且輸入docker命令無響應?
排行榜
